Key Considerations for Virtual Zumba Instructor Qualification
Navigating the landscape of acquiring Zumba instructor certification through an online modality requires careful consideration. The following recommendations aim to optimize the experience and ensure attainment of a recognized and valuable credential.
Tip 1: Verify Accreditation. Prior to enrollment, confirm the offering is officially recognized by Zumba Fitness, LLC. Non-accredited programs may not provide the necessary qualifications to teach licensed Zumba classes.
Tip 2: Review Curriculum Detail. Examine the syllabus to ascertain comprehensive coverage of fundamental Zumba steps, choreography, musicality, and cueing techniques. Inadequate curriculum may result in insufficient preparation for practical instruction.
Tip 3: Evaluate Instructor Credentials. Research the qualifications and experience of the lead instructor(s). Experienced and certified Zumba Education Specialists (ZES) typically provide superior guidance and mentorship.
Tip 4: Assess Technological Requirements. Confirm the compatibility of the chosen platform with existing hardware and internet connectivity. Technical limitations can hinder the learning experience and impede successful completion.
Tip 5: Investigate Support Systems. Determine the availability of technical support, instructor Q&A sessions, and peer networking opportunities. Robust support systems facilitate learning and address potential challenges.
Tip 6: Understand Certification Renewal Policies. Clarify the requirements for maintaining active certification, including continuing education credits and associated fees. Failure to comply may result in the lapse of instructor privileges.
These tips are designed to guide prospective students in making informed decisions. Careful evaluation of these aspects helps to ensure a successful and valuable certification. 1. Accessibility
Accessibility plays a critical role in shaping the reach and impact of Zumba instructor qualification programs delivered online. It directly influences who can participate and benefit from acquiring the skills and credentials to teach Zumba classes.
- Geographic Reach
Online platforms overcome geographical limitations. Individuals in remote locations or areas lacking local training options can access the same instruction as those in urban centers. This expands opportunities for certification beyond traditional boundaries.
- Schedule Flexibility
Asynchronous learning allows students to engage with course materials at their own pace and on their own schedule. This is particularly beneficial for individuals with demanding work schedules or other commitments that make attending fixed-time classes difficult.
- Cost-Effectiveness
Virtual offerings often reduce expenses associated with travel, accommodation, and facility rentals. This lower financial barrier makes instructor training more accessible to individuals with limited resources or those residing in areas with high costs of living.
- Adaptive Learning
Online platforms can incorporate features that cater to diverse learning styles and abilities. This might include closed captions, adjustable playback speeds, and interactive elements. These adaptations help ensure that instruction is accessible to a wider range of students, including those with disabilities or learning differences.
These facets of accessibility collectively contribute to democratizing Zumba instructor qualification. By removing barriers related to geography, time, cost, and learning style, virtual programs empower a more diverse population to become certified instructors, extending the reach and impact of Zumba within communities worldwide.

4. Certification Validity
Certification validity constitutes a critical component of any Zumba certification course delivered online. The legitimacy of the certification directly impacts an instructor’s ability to legally and ethically teach Zumba classes, safeguarding both the instructor and the participants. A valid certification, obtained through an authorized Zumba Education Specialist (ZES) via official Zumba Fitness, LLC channels, demonstrates adherence to established standards of practice. It confirms the instructor possesses the foundational knowledge, skills, and techniques necessary to lead a safe and effective Zumba class. Without a valid certification, instructors may face legal ramifications and may not be covered by Zumba Fitness, LLC’s insurance policies, creating potential liabilities.
The practical application of this understanding is evident in various scenarios. Consider a hypothetical Zumba instructor operating without valid certification. This individual may lack essential knowledge regarding proper form, injury prevention, and modifications for diverse fitness levels. This could lead to participant injury, resulting in legal action. Furthermore, unauthorized use of the Zumba trademark can result in legal consequences, including cease and desist orders and financial penalties. In contrast, a certified instructor with valid credentials has undergone approved training, understands legal and ethical considerations, and can provide participants with a safe and effective Zumba experience. They also have access to ongoing support and resources from Zumba Fitness, LLC, including marketing materials and continuing education opportunities.

Frequently Asked Questions
The following addresses prevalent inquiries regarding acquiring Zumba instructor certification through virtual platforms.
Question 1: What constitutes a valid Zumba Certification Course Online?
A legitimate program receives accreditation from Zumba Fitness, LLC. The official Zumba website provides a directory of recognized providers.
Question 2: Are there prerequisites for enrolling in a Zumba Certification Course Online?
Specific prerequisites vary depending on the provider. However, a general level of physical fitness is advisable. Some providers may require basic dance or fitness experience.
Question 3: What are the key components typically covered in a Zumba Certification Course Online curriculum?
The curriculum typically includes foundational Zumba steps, choreography construction, music integration, cueing techniques, and class management strategies. Basic anatomy and injury prevention may also be addressed.
Question 4: What is the typical duration of a Zumba Certification Course Online?
The duration varies, but most courses range from several hours to multiple days. The time commitment depends on the course’s depth and intensity.
Question 5: How is proficiency assessed in a Zumba Certification Course Online?
Assessment methods may include video submissions of choreography demonstrations, written examinations, and participation in live or recorded training sessions. Providers utilize a variety of methods.
Question 6: What are the continuing education requirements to maintain Zumba certification obtained through an online course?
Zumba Fitness, LLC mandates continuing education credits to maintain active certification. Requirements may include attending workshops, participating in online training, or completing approved courses.
